Hint of Lime chips are a type of flavored tortilla chip originating from Mexican cuisine, where lime is a common addition to snacks and dishes for its tangy flavor. These chips are typically made from corn masa and seasoned with lime and salt, and sometimes include hints of other spices or flavors. Nutritionally, they are high in carbohydrates and contain a moderate amount of fats, primarily from vegetable oil used in their preparation. While they provide energy, they are not a significant source of protein, vitamins, or minerals. Portion sizes should be monitored as they can be calorie-dense and may contain sodium in higher amounts.

Hint of Lime Chips are not high in protein, offering about 2 grams of protein per 1-ounce (28-gram) serving. These chips are primarily made from corn, which is not a significant protein source.
Hint of Lime Chips are not suitable for a keto diet as they are high in carbohydrates, with approximately 18 grams of carbs per 1-ounce serving. This exceeds typical carb limits for a ketogenic diet.
Hint of Lime Chips are high in sodium, with around 120-150 milligrams per serving, and they contain processed ingredients. Regular consumption may contribute to excessive sodium intake, which could raise blood pressure in sensitive individuals.
The recommended serving size for Hint of Lime Chips is 1 ounce, which is about 10-12 chips. This serving contains approximately 140 calories, so portion control is important to avoid overconsuming calories.
Hint of Lime Chips are similar in calories and fat content to plain tortilla chips but are higher in sodium and flavoring due to the lime seasoning. If watching sodium intake, you may prefer plain tortilla chips.
